T-Mobile launches SuperBroadband with 5G FWA and Starlink

Source: esim.report via Phil Akhnazarov on InoreaderApril 30, 2026

T-Mobile announced SuperBroadband on April 30, 2026, a business internet service that combines its 5G fixed wireless access (FWA) network with Starlink satellite connectivity.

T-Mobile said SuperBroadband pairs its 5G fixed wireless access (FWA), which delivers home or business broadband over a mobile network, with Starlink satellite connectivity. The company said the service is a business internet offer rather than a consumer product.

T-Mobile said the service is intended for enterprises in remote and rural regions. The company said combining terrestrial 5G FWA with Starlink is meant to extend coverage in places where a single access technology may not be sufficient.

T-Mobile said SuperBroadband also provides built-in redundancy. The company presented the hybrid broadband offer as a way to maintain connectivity for business customers if one network path is unavailable.
